editor: Improve code completion filtering to provide fewer and more accurate suggestions (#32928)
Closes #32756

- Uses `filter_text` from LSP source to filter items in completion list.
This fixes noisy lists like on typing `await` in Rust, it would suggest
`await.or`, `await.and`, etc., which are bad suggestions. Fallbacks to
label.
- Add `penalize_length` flag to fuzzy matcher, which was the default
behavior across. Now, this flag is set to `false` just for code
completion fuzzy matching. This fixes the case where if the query is
`unreac` and the completion items are `unreachable` and
`unreachable!()`, the item with a shorter length would have a larger
score than the other one, which is not right in the case of
auto-complete context. Now these two items will have the same fuzzy
score, and LSP `sort_text` will take over in finalizing its ranking.
- Updated test to be more utility based rather than example based. This
will help to iterate/verify logic faster on what's going on.

use futures::channel::oneshot;
use fuzzy::{StringMatch, StringMatchCandidate};
use core::cmp;
use gpui::{
App, Context, DismissEvent, Entity, EventEmitter, FocusHandle, Focusable, InteractiveElement,
IntoElement, ParentElement, Render, SharedString, Styled, Subscription, Task, WeakEntity,
Window, rems,
};
use picker::{Picker, PickerDelegate};
use std::sync::Arc;
use ui::{HighlightedLabel, ListItem, ListItemSpacing, prelude::*};
use util::ResultExt;
use workspace::{ModalView, Workspace};
pub struct PickerPrompt {
pub picker: Entity<Picker<PickerPromptDelegate>>,
rem_width: f32,
_subscription: Subscription,
}
pub fn prompt(
prompt: &str,
options: Vec<SharedString>,
workspace: WeakEntity<Workspace>,
window: &mut Window,
cx: &mut App,
) -> Task<Option<usize>> {
if options.is_empty() {
return Task::ready(None);
} else if options.len() == 1 {
return Task::ready(Some(0));
}
let prompt = prompt.to_string().into();
window.spawn(cx, async move |cx| {
// Modal branch picker has a longer trailoff than a popover one.
let (tx, rx) = oneshot::channel();
let delegate = PickerPromptDelegate::new(prompt, options, tx, 70);
workspace
.update_in(cx, |workspace, window, cx| {
workspace.toggle_modal(window, cx, |window, cx| {
PickerPrompt::new(delegate, 34., window, cx)
})
})
.ok();
(rx.await).ok()
})
}
impl PickerPrompt {
fn new(
delegate: PickerPromptDelegate,
rem_width: f32,
window: &mut Window,
cx: &mut Context<Self>,
) -> Self {
let picker = cx.new(|cx| Picker::uniform_list(delegate, window, cx));
let _subscription = cx.subscribe(&picker, |_, _, _, cx| cx.emit(DismissEvent));
Self {
picker,
rem_width,
_subscription,
}
}
}
impl ModalView for PickerPrompt {}
impl EventEmitter<DismissEvent> for PickerPrompt {}
impl Focusable for PickerPrompt {
fn focus_handle(&self, cx: &App) -> FocusHandle {
self.picker.focus_handle(cx)
}
}
impl Render for PickerPrompt {
fn render(&mut self, _: &mut Window, cx: &mut Context<Self>) -> impl IntoElement {
v_flex()
.w(rems(self.rem_width))
.child(self.picker.clone())
.on_mouse_down_out(cx.listener(|this, _, window, cx| {
this.picker.update(cx, |this, cx| {
this.cancel(&Default::default(), window, cx);
})
}))
}
}
pub struct PickerPromptDelegate {
prompt: Arc<str>,
matches: Vec<StringMatch>,
all_options: Vec<SharedString>,
selected_index: usize,
max_match_length: usize,
tx: Option<oneshot::Sender<usize>>,
}
impl PickerPromptDelegate {
pub fn new(
prompt: Arc<str>,
options: Vec<SharedString>,
tx: oneshot::Sender<usize>,
max_chars: usize,
) -> Self {
Self {
prompt,
all_options: options,
matches: vec![],
selected_index: 0,
max_match_length: max_chars,
tx: Some(tx),
}
}
}
impl PickerDelegate for PickerPromptDelegate {
type ListItem = ListItem;
fn placeholder_text(&self, _window: &mut Window, _cx: &mut App) -> Arc<str> {
self.prompt.clone()
}
fn match_count(&self) -> usize {
self.matches.len()
}
fn selected_index(&self) -> usize {
self.selected_index
}
fn set_selected_index(
&mut self,
ix: usize,
_window: &mut Window,
_: &mut Context<Picker<Self>>,
) {
self.selected_index = ix;
}
fn update_matches(
&mut self,
query: String,
window: &mut Window,
cx: &mut Context<Picker<Self>>,
) -> Task<()> {
cx.spawn_in(window, async move |picker, cx| {
let candidates = picker.read_with(cx, |picker, _| {
picker
.delegate
.all_options
.iter()
.enumerate()
.map(|(ix, option)| StringMatchCandidate::new(ix, &option))
.collect::<Vec<StringMatchCandidate>>()
});
let Some(candidates) = candidates.log_err() else {
return;
};
let matches: Vec<StringMatch> = if query.is_empty() {
candidates
.into_iter()
.enumerate()
.map(|(index, candidate)| StringMatch {
candidate_id: index,
string: candidate.string,
positions: Vec::new(),
score: 0.0,
})
.collect()
} else {
fuzzy::match_strings(
&candidates,
&query,
true,
true,
10000,
&Default::default(),
cx.background_executor().clone(),
)
.await
};
picker
.update(cx, |picker, _| {
let delegate = &mut picker.delegate;
delegate.matches = matches;
if delegate.matches.is_empty() {
delegate.selected_index = 0;
} else {
delegate.selected_index =
cmp::min(delegate.selected_index, delegate.matches.len() - 1);
}
})
.log_err();
})
}
fn confirm(&mut self, _: bool, _window: &mut Window, cx: &mut Context<Picker<Self>>) {
let Some(option) = self.matches.get(self.selected_index()) else {
return;
};
self.tx.take().map(|tx| tx.send(option.candidate_id));
cx.emit(DismissEvent);
}
fn dismissed(&mut self, _: &mut Window, cx: &mut Context<Picker<Self>>) {
cx.emit(DismissEvent);
}
fn render_match(
&self,
ix: usize,
selected: bool,
_window: &mut Window,
_cx: &mut Context<Picker<Self>>,
) -> Option<Self::ListItem> {
let hit = &self.matches[ix];
let shortened_option = util::truncate_and_trailoff(&hit.string, self.max_match_length);
Some(
ListItem::new(SharedString::from(format!("picker-prompt-menu-{ix}")))
.inset(true)
.spacing(ListItemSpacing::Sparse)
.toggle_state(selected)
.map(|el| {
let highlights: Vec<_> = hit
.positions
.iter()
.filter(|index| index < &&self.max_match_length)
.copied()
.collect();
el.child(HighlightedLabel::new(shortened_option, highlights))
}),
)
}
}
